Abstract:
In this work we present a novel approach to acoustic scene analysis with microphone arrays. Acoustic measurements are here represented in the ray space, which is defined as the space of parameters that describe acoustic rays. The ray space can be thought of as the domain of the plenacoustic function, which defines the sound pressure field in all positions in space. We discuss sampling and distortion with respect to the ideal plenacoustic function introduced using a microphone array. Plenacoustic images can potentially be used for environment inference, source characterization and wavefield extrapolation. Index Terms — Plenacoustic function, acoustic images.
